Some No-Limit Hands

Level 25

No-Limit Hold'em

Hand #224: John Hennigan opened for 200,000 from the small blind and Matthew Ashton defended from the big. The latter then called a bet of 175,000 from the former on the {k-Diamonds}{j-Clubs}{5-Clubs} flop and the dealer burned and turned the {2-Clubs}, which both players checked.

When the {10-Hearts} completed the board on the river, Hennigan bet 300,000 and Ashton called.

"You got it," Hennigan admitted prompting Ashton to table the {k-Spades}{9-Clubs} for the win.

Hand #226: Ashton made it 160,000 from the button, both his opponents called and it was three-way action to the {a-Diamonds}{3-Clubs}{2-Clubs} flop. Two checks put action on Ashton and he bet 240,000. Don Nguyen folded and then Hennigan woke up with a check-raise to 500,000, which Ashton called. Both players checked the {A-Spades} turn and then Hennigan fired out 700,000 on the {5-Clubs} river. Ashton thought for a brief moment and then folded his hand.
